ddl.sql 2.95 KB
#测试表
DROP TABLE  IF EXISTS test;
CREATE TABLE test(
	id int(4) PRIMARY KEY NOT NULL auto_increment COMMENT '产品主键',
	name VARCHAR(128) NOT NULL COMMENT '名称',
	age int(4) NOT NULL COMMENT '年龄'
);
INSERT INTO test(name,age) VALUES("A","1");

#mybatis测试表
DROP TABLE  IF EXISTS mybatis_test;
CREATE TABLE mybatis_test(
	id int(4) PRIMARY KEY NOT NULL auto_increment COMMENT '产品主键',
	name VARCHAR(128) NOT NULL COMMENT '名称',
	age int(4) NOT NULL COMMENT '年龄'
);
INSERT INTO mybatis_test(name,age) VALUES("C","111");

#支付表
DROP TABLE  IF EXISTS alipay;
CREATE TABLE alipay(
	id int(8) primary key not null auto_increment comment '主键ID',
	out_trade_no varchar(64) not null comment '订单号',
	subject varchar(255) not null comment '商品名称',
	payment_type varchar(4) not null comment '支付类型',
	trade_no varchar(64) comment '支付宝交易号',
	trade_status enum('WAIT_BUYER_PAY','TRADE_CLOSE','TRADE_SUCCESS','TRADE_PENDING','TRADE_FINISH','REFUND_SUCCESS','REFUND_CLOSED') not null comment '交易状态',
	buyer_id varchar(30) comment '用户支付宝ID',
	total_fee float not null comment '交易金额',
	body varchar(255) comment '商品描述',
	return_url varchar(255) comment '回调地址',
	gmt_create datetime not null comment '交易创建时间',
	gmt_trade_status datetime not null comment '交易状态更新时间'
) ENGINE=MyISAM DEFAULT CHARSET=utf8;

select * from alipay;

DROP TABLE  IF EXISTS pay_log;
CREATE TABLE pay_log(
	id int(8) primary key not null auto_increment comment '主键ID',
	pay_id int(8) not null comment '支付表主键id',
	out_trade_no varchar(64) not null comment '订单号',
	subject varchar(256) not null comment '商品名称',
	payment_type varchar(4) not null comment '支付类型',
	trade_no varchar(64) comment '支付宝交易号',
	trade_status enum('WAIT_BUYER_PAY','TRADE_CLOSE','TRADE_SUCCESS','TRADE_PENDING','TRADE_FINISH','REFUND_SUCCESS','REFUND_CLOSED') not null comment '交易状态',
	buyer_id varchar(30) comment '用户支付宝ID',
	total_fee float not null comment '交易金额',
	body varchar(400) comment '商品描述',
	return_url varchar(255) comment '回调地址',
	gmt_create datetime not null comment '交易创建时间'
) ENGINE=MyISAM DEFAULT CHARSET=utf8;

#文件存储表
DROP TABLE  IF EXISTS sys_file;
CREATE TABLE sys_file(
	id INT(4) PRIMARY KEY NOT NULL auto_increment COMMENT '主键',
	name VARCHAR(128) NOT NULL COMMENT '名称',
	file_key VARCHAR(128) NOT NULL COMMENT '文件key',
	usageType VARCHAR(32) NOT NULL COMMENT '使用类型',
	uri VARCHAR(128) NOT NULL COMMENT '文件存储路径',
	compress_uri VARCHAR(512) COMMENT '压缩文件存储路径',
	create_date DATE NOT NULL COMMENT '创建时间',
	update_date DATE NOT NULL COMMENT '更新时间'
);
#测试脚本
#INSERT INTO sys_file(name,file_key,usageType,uri,compress_uri,create_date,update_date) VALUES('file_name','key',0,'uri','compress_uri','2016-05-01','2016-05-05');
#select * from sys_file;